Entry-Level Ultrasound Technologist Salary in Costa Mesa, CA: $95,338 (2026)
Quick Answer:New ultrasound technologists entering the Costa Mesa, CA job market in 2026 can expect a starting salary around $95,338 (BLS 10th-percentile benchmark for SOC 29-2032, projected from 2025 OEWS data). Stripping out Costa Mesa's local price level (BEA RPP 113.1 — 13% above national), a first-year paycheck buys what $84,295 would in average-cost America. Most reach the city median ($137,283) within a few years of clinical practice.

Salary Trajectory for Ultrasound Technologists in Costa Mesa (2019–2027)
2019–2025: actual BLS OEWS data for this metro area. 2026+: CAGR 4.93% projection.
| Year | Annual Salary | Status |
|---|---|---|
| 2019 | $70,696 | Actual |
| 2020 | $72,063 | Actual |
| 2021 | $79,900 | Actual |
| 2022 | $82,298 | Actual |
| 2023 | $85,313 | Actual |
| 2024 | $101,001 | Actual |
| 2025 | $90,859 | Actual |
| 2026(current) | $95,338 | Estimated |
| 2027 | $100,039 | Projected |
Entry-level ultrasound technologist compensation (10th percentile) in Costa Mesa, CA grew 28.5% over 7 years based on actual BLS metropolitan area surveys, rising from $70,696 in 2019 to $90,859 in 2025. By 2027, starting salaries are projected to reach $100,039. New graduates entering the Costa Mesa job market can expect continued year-over-year gains.
Note: Historical values (2019–2025) are actual BLS OEWS figures for the Costa Mesa metropolitan area, sourced from annual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ics surveys. 2026–2026 figures are current estimates, and 2027 values are projections, calculated using a 4.93% CAGR derived from 7-year BLS historical data.
